Pair arrested at hospital on weapons charges
- Share via
From Times Staff and Wire Reports
Los Angeles County police arrested a man and woman in the parking lot of the urgent care center at Martin Luther King Jr.-Harbor Hospital on Sunday morning on felony weapons charges.
Officers were investigating a 1998 white Yukon when a 22-year-old woman approached and said she owned the car, said Assistant Chief Steve Lieber.
While talking to the woman, officers saw the butt of an assault rifle poking out from under a blue sheet inside the car.
The woman and a 24-year-old male companion were arrested.
